We may have a problem. I was just going thru my spam folder to clean it out and noticed a total of 6 messages about the upgrade. Problem is they all have different addresses on them, but the message is identical. The message:

Yahoo! MAIL  

Dear Valid Customer, Your Mail Version is outdated, Failure to upgrade to the new Yahoo Mail 7.1 will now result in a permanent account closure. According to Provision 17.9 Terms and Conditions, Yahoo may at any time terminate your service from sending and receiving from this account. To ensure your safety on our service for this account we urge you to Upgrade on the attached link below for verification of your account.

Open Attached Link

Thanks, Yahoo! Customer Service.
